Arrow star Stephen Amell took to Twitter to thank WWE fans for their potential involvement in the bump for the show’s season premiere. The episode brought in 2.67 million viewers and a 1.1 rating in the 18 – 49 demographic, with the demo rating up from last season’s premiere.
Amell posted:
Thanks to everyone in the @WWE Universe who checked out the show. Had our biggest premiere since launching in 2012. #NotAnAccident
— Stephen Amell (@amellywood) October 8, 2015
